Grams in a Cup of Cottage Cheese

Many recipes often call for cottage cheese as an ingredient. Cottage cheese is a versatile dairy product that can be used in various dishes, from savory to sweet. One common measurement question that arises is how many grams make up a cup of cottage cheese.

Standard Measurement

Generally, a cup of cottage cheese is equivalent to around 240 grams. This measurement provides a convenient reference point for cooking and baking. However, it is essential to note that the weight of cottage cheese can vary slightly depending on factors such as density and moisture content.

Converting Measurements

If you need to convert cottage cheese from cups to grams or vice versa, you can use the following general conversions:

  • 1 cup of cottage cheese is approximately 240 grams
  • 1 gram is roughly 0.0042 cups of cottage cheese
